Question:

If radius of nucleus with mass number 64 is 4.8 fermi, find mass number of nucleus of radius 6 fermi.

Show Hint

Radius of nucleus is proportional to \( A^{1/3} \)

The Correct Option is D

Solution and Explanation

\[ R = R_0 A^{1/3} \Rightarrow \left( \frac{6}{4.8} \right)^3 = \left( \frac{A}{64} \right) \Rightarrow A = 64 \cdot \left( \frac{6}{4.8} \right)^3 = 125 \]
